Biography

Mr. Twedt is a registered professional engineer in the state of South à£à£Ö±²¥Ðã and has been performing energy assessments, system and equipment economic feasibility studies and analyzing energy and bio-energy systems since 1992. In this time he has conducted over 300 energy assessments on public and private facilities in Iowa, Minnesota, Nebraska, North à£à£Ö±²¥Ðã and South à£à£Ö±²¥Ðã. He is currently the director for the SDSU Energy Analysis Lab and the Wind Application Center where he is involved with several research projects dealing with energy conversion, wind energy development, bio-energy conversion and bio-processing. Mr. Twedt’s core specialties include energy analysis, energy efficiency, mechanical systems and HVAC design, industrial systems optimization, economic justification analysis and cost reduction analysis.
